Supramolecular self-assembled peptide hydrogels Ac-L-Phe-L-Phe-L-Ala-NH2 for vaccine delivery with adjuvant activity
Adjuvants are used in order to enhance vaccine potency by improvement of the humoral and cellmediated immune response to vaccine antigens. Adjuvants of new generation often include different biocompatible nanomaterials for sustained release of antigen and at the same time have adjuvant properties themselves. Supramolecular self-assembled peptide hydrogels have a great potential for applications in bionanotechnology and it has been shown that certain peptides possess immunostimulatory activity (1). We report here the adjuvant system based on supramolecular hydrogel of a self- assembling tripeptide Ac-L-Phe-L-Phe-L-Ala-NH2 (2) and evaluated for their in vivo adjuvant activity. The results of our experiment have shown that the examined hydrogels based on Ac-Phe-Phe-AlaNH2 and tripeptides Ac-Phe-Phe--Ala-OMe and Ac-Phe-Phe- Ala-OH induce a strong specific immune response in mice compared to the antigen itself. Also, these three adjuvant formulations modulated the type of specific immunoreaction
